Any experience with the ThumbCTL ActiveX control?
Versions des environnements
Hi All, I'm working on a Document Management project and I was looking for a control that could display thumbnails of the several file types, including DOC, XLS, PPT, TIF, JPG, PDF. Browsing through the ActiveX controls on my systems, I found ThumbCtl, which is really simple to use and does a much better job of sizing & rendering graphics than the standard VFP image control. It's a control that's been included with MS's OSs for quite a while.
According to the info that I could find on it (which wasn't much), it should be able to display thumbnails for all of the file types I listed, with the exception of PDFs. It's simple to use by passing the file path & name to DisplayFile().
It works fine for most file types (even displays a Visio thumbnail), but for some reason, I can't get it to display thumbs for Word or Excel docs.
Any ideas or recommenations?
